Japan is ramping up domestic drone production to cut reliance on Chinese manufacturers. Prime Minister Sanae Takaichi seeks to reduce dependence on China, with startups Eams Robotics and Terra Drone shifting from civilian to military drone manufacturing. Funding for interceptor drones and autonomous defense systems has increased dramatically.
